Communication Skills Learning Track

The Communication Skills Learning Track is a five-course series on how to increase your effectiveness as a communicator.

Learning Track Outline: Course 1: Connecting through Communication

During this interactive course, we will define the term “communication”, outline the different levels of communication, and explore the best channels of communication to use, depending on the message.

Course 2: You as a Communicator

This course is about you—and how your thoughts, beliefs, feelings and perceptions contribute to the way you communicate. During this course, we‘ll investigate the effect our thoughts and beliefs have on how we communicate, and discuss the powerful impact of nonverbal communication.

Course 3: Conversation Starters

“Conversation starters” are the casual conversations that begin almost every communication. They play an important role because they create an impression and open the way to build rapport and develop relationships. In this course, we’ll explore ways you can initiate a conversation and keep it rolling.

Course 4: Conducting Meaningful Conversations

Meaningful conversations are more important in business today than ever before. Due to the increased complexity of today’s business environment, no single individual has all of the information needed to solve problems or make decisions. During this course, we’ll explore what makes a conversation meaningful, and introduce the tools and techniques for conducting meaningful conversations.

Course 5: Tackling Tough Conversations

Right now there’s probably someone you should speak to about an important issue. Maybe you're avoiding the conversation, or have tried once without success and are reluctant to try again. Silence may be the path of least resistance, but these unresolved issues don’t simply go away. Instead they smolder and often intensify. During this course, we’ll explore how to prepare for tough conversations, and we’ll investigate skills to deal with the emotions that arise during tough conversations.
